What Is the LG ClOiD Home Robot?
ClOiD is LG’s first general-purpose humanoid robot built specifically for indoor household environments. Unlike single-purpose robots like vacuum cleaners, ClOiD features a human-optimized form factor with articulated arms and hands capable of manipulating a wide variety of household objects. The robot was showcased at LG’s booth (#15004, Las Vegas Convention Center) during CES 2026, held January 6-9.
LG established the HS Robotics Lab within its Home Appliance Solution Company specifically to develop ClOiD’s core technologies. The company views robotics as a strategic future growth engine and has pursued joint research initiatives with leading robotics firms in Korea and globally.
The robot represents a significant engineering leap beyond LG’s existing CLOi product line, which previously consisted of service robots for commercial hospitality and healthcare settings. ClOiD targets the consumer home market directly, competing with Tesla’s Optimus, 1X’s NEO, and other emerging humanoid home assistants.
Core Technical Specifications
Articulated Arms & Dexterity System
ClOiD’s two arms are powered by motors delivering seven degrees of freedom each, providing versatile motion patterns similar to natural human arm movements. This configuration allows the robot to reach objects at various heights and angles throughout typical living spaces.
Each hand features five individually actuated fingers, enabling advanced dexterity for delicate and precise tasks that require fine motor control. This finger design represents a critical differentiator many competing robots use simplified gripper mechanisms with 2-3 contact points, while ClOiD’s five-finger system can manipulate irregular-shaped objects, operate appliance controls, and handle fragile items like glassware.
For context, Boston Dynamics’ Atlas robot features 29 degrees of freedom in its upper body alone, while SwitchBot’s Onero H1 touts impressive DoF capabilities but operates on a wheeled base rather than a humanoid form. ClOiD’s 14 degrees of freedom (7 per arm) plus finger articulation falls in the mid-range for manipulation-focused robots, prioritizing household task versatility over industrial-grade complexity.
Affectionate Intelligence AI Platform
LG powers ClOiD with what it calls “Affectionate Intelligence” an AI system designed to learn from interactions, recognize patterns in household routines, and refine its responses over time to provide increasingly personalized support. The platform uses visual language models to interpret surroundings, similar to advanced systems deployed in other humanoid robots.
The AI enables ClOiD to navigate homes autonomously, detect when tasks require attention, and interact through a built-in display and speaker. The robot can adapt to residents’ schedules and lifestyles, theoretically learning preferences like how you fold towels, where you store cleaning supplies, or when you typically prepare meals.
LG has not disclosed the specific large language model (LLM) or vision-language model (VLM) powering ClOiD’s intelligence layer. For comparison, Figure AI’s robots utilize OpenAI’s multimodal models, while Tesla Optimus leverages the same AI stack that powers Tesla vehicles’ Full Self-Driving capabilities.
Form Factor & Mobility Design
ClOiD features a “suitable form factor optimized for today’s living environments,” according to LG’s official announcement. While exact dimensions and weight specifications were not disclosed in the CES 2026 reveal, the robot is designed to operate smoothly in spaces built around human body proportions.
Unlike wheeled service robots, ClOiD’s humanoid configuration allows it to navigate stairs, reach high shelves, and interact with environments designed for bipedal humans. This represents a mobility advantage over competitors like Samsung’s Ballie and SwitchBot’s Onero H1, which are constrained to single-floor operation.
The robot incorporates multiple cameras and sensors throughout its head, arms, hands, and torso to enhance perception capabilities. These sensors enable real-time environmental mapping, obstacle avoidance, and object recognition necessary for autonomous task completion.
What Can ClOiD Actually Do?
Household Task Capabilities
LG designed ClOiD to perform a wide range of indoor household tasks, though the company has been strategic about not overpromising specific capabilities before real-world testing. Based on the CES 2026 demonstration and official communications, ClOiD targets these task categories:
- Laundry management: Folding clothes, sorting items, transferring loads between washer and dryer
- Organization: Arranging items on shelves, decluttering surfaces, sorting mail
- Light cleaning: Wiping counters, organizing kitchens, straightening living spaces
- Object manipulation: Carrying items between rooms, opening doors, operating appliance controls
- Home coordination: Serving as a central AI assistant to manage other smart devices
The robot’s delicate manipulation capabilities distinguish it from earlier robotic assistants that struggled with fine motor skills. ClOiD’s five-finger hands enable it to grasp irregular objects, operate touchscreens, and handle fragile items, tasks that remain challenging for many industrial robots.

Smart Home Integration
ClOiD is designed to connect seamlessly with other LG appliances and third-party smart home devices, creating a unified network where the robot can control lighting, temperature, and security systems. This interconnected approach positions ClOiD as a central hub for home management, potentially reducing the need for multiple apps or voice assistants.
The robot can interpret voice commands, gesture recognition, and touchscreen input, making it accessible even for users with limited technical experience. This user-centric interface design could accelerate adoption, especially in households seeking AI integration without steep learning curves.
LG’s existing smart home ecosystem which includes AI-enabled appliances, ThinQ platform integration, and voice assistant compatibility provides ClOiD with an established foundation for device coordination. The robot can theoretically manage refrigerator settings, adjust washing machine cycles, control HVAC systems, and orchestrate lighting scenes based on learned preferences.

ClOiD vs Tesla Optimus
Tesla Optimus brings automotive manufacturing expertise and advanced AI capabilities derived from the company’s Full Self-Driving platform. Optimus features 22 degrees of freedom in its Gen 3 hands alone, significantly more complex than ClOiD’s disclosed specifications. The robot has demonstrated impressive spatial awareness, capable of mapping environments in real-time and avoiding obstacles with precision.
LG counters with established consumer electronics manufacturing and global distribution networks that could enable faster scaling to consumer markets. ClOiD’s integration with LG’s existing appliance ecosystem provides a practical advantage for households already invested in LG smart home products.
Pricing estimates place Optimus around $25,000, though Tesla has not confirmed consumer availability timelines. LG has not announced ClOiD pricing, making direct cost comparison premature.
ClOiD vs 1X NEO
1X’s NEO robot emphasizes safety and silent operation, featuring a soft body designed specifically for family environments with children and elderly residents. NEO is available for $20,000 upfront or through a $499/month subscription model, the first humanoid home robot to offer flexible payment options.
NEO’s design philosophy prioritizes a non-threatening appearance (described as “a person in a tracksuit”) and maximum safety, while ClOiD focuses on task versatility through advanced manipulation capabilities. NEO robots are currently in pre-production beta phase with select customers.
ClOiD’s five individually actuated fingers suggest greater manipulation precision for complex household tasks, while NEO’s soft-grip design optimizes for safe human interaction over delicate object handling.
ClOiD vs SwitchBot Onero H1
SwitchBot’s Onero H1, also unveiled at CES 2026, takes a hybrid approach with articulated arms mounted on a wheeled base rather than a full humanoid form. This design trades stair navigation capability for enhanced stability and lower manufacturing complexity.
Onero’s key advantage lies in orchestration it’s designed to coordinate with SwitchBot’s existing ecosystem of task-specific robots including vacuums, humidifiers, and air purifiers. This positions Onero as an “embodied smart home assistant” rather than a standalone task executor.
ClOiD’s humanoid form factor enables stair access and vertical reach that wheeled competitors cannot match, but may introduce balance and navigation complexities that wheeled platforms avoid. SwitchBot announced that Onero H1 will be available for preorder soon, giving it a potential time-to-market advantage.
The “Zero Labor Home” Vision Explained
LG’s “Zero Labor Home, Makes Quality Time” concept represents the company’s long-term goal of freeing customers from time-consuming housework demands. The vision extends beyond a single robot it encompasses an integrated ecosystem where ClOiD coordinates with smart appliances, sensors, and AI systems to automate home management comprehensively.
Baik Seung-tae, Senior Vice President at LG Electronics, explained that the company aims to “showcase our vision of a ‘zero-labor home’ at CES 2026,” positioning robotics as central to LG’s future growth strategy. This represents a fundamental shift for LG from manufacturing individual smart appliances to orchestrating holistic home automation solutions.
The concept faces significant technical hurdles. General-purpose home robots must navigate chaotic environments, manipulate thousands of different object types, adapt to unique household layouts, and operate safely around children and pets. As one analysis noted, this represents “the consumer tech industry’s equivalent of a moonshot”.
Practical implementation also raises questions about maintenance, reliability, and user expectations. Early adopters of home robots frequently report that video demonstrations differ significantly from real-world performance. LG will need to manage customer expectations carefully to avoid the disappointment that has plagued previous robotic home assistant launches.
